As nouns, photocoagulation is a hyponym of surgical process; that is, photocoagulation is a word with a more specific, narrower meaning than surgical process:
  • surgical process: a medical procedure involving an incision with instruments; performed to repair damage or arrest disease in a living body
  • photocoagulation: surgical procedure that uses an intense laser beam to destroy diseased retinal tissue or to make a scar that will hold the retina in cases of detached retina
